Transaction 54d94d104c40fd4ced1b6931c30df1a9c8fee9b7bb1742574942181e77404fb3
1 Input
1 Output
-
54d94d104c40fd4ced1b6931c30df1a9c8fee9b7bb1742574942181e77404fb3:0
- value
- 623184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 532ba3ad133ed74751d39b8beed8c5a21cf572a7 OP_EQUAL
- address
- 39GnHaga3iWWUZ7Geqk6oXZtBArooWqyLP